New DaKine Photo Pack
The new DaKine Reload (30L) Photo Pack made its way into my quiver recently. It is pretty different from my old photo pack from Dakine. The bag looks amazing with the normal DaKine build quality. I’m most excited about how high it sits on your back as compared to before. This should make hiking around with all that gear a lot easier. The hardest thing to get use to is the zipper to access the main compartment is completely opposite the old pack, which has taken some getting use to.
